A Familiar Name With a Fresh New Direction

The Bolt has long been known as a practical electric vehicle with impressive efficiency and easy-to-drive dimensions. The 2027 model builds on that reputation with a more modern design, upgraded charging capability, and an interior that feels more advanced and comfortable. Chevrolet has made it clear that Bolt is not simply returning as a familiar option. It is coming back with meaningful updates that address what many EV shoppers care about most: range, charging speed, technology, comfort, safety, and overall value.

One of the biggest highlights is charging performance. Chevrolet notes that the new Bolt features public DC fast charging that is more than 2.5 times faster than the previous Bolt EUV. With a GM-estimated 10% to 80% charging time of about 25 minutes when using compatible DC fast charging, Bolt is better prepared for busier schedules and longer drives. The standard NACS charge port is also important because it helps connect Bolt drivers to a larger world of public charging, including access to many compatible Tesla Superchargers.

Electric Range That Supports Real Life

Range is often one of the first questions EV shoppers ask, and the 2027 Chevrolet Bolt answers with confidence. The EPA-estimated 262 miles of electric range gives drivers flexibility for daily commuting, school drop-offs, grocery runs, local appointments, and many weekend activities without needing to plan every mile. For shoppers comparing compact EVs, that balance of range and affordability may be one of Bolt’s strongest advantages.

Just as important, Chevrolet recommends regularly charging the new battery technology to 100% capacity to help achieve the fastest overall charging speeds. That is a useful detail for EV shoppers who may be used to hearing different charging guidance from different brands. Bolt is designed to be straightforward, and that simplicity can make EV ownership feel less complicated for first-time electric drivers.

  • Estimated range: Up to 262 EPA-estimated miles of electric driving
  • Fast charging: GM-estimated 10% to 80% charging in about 25 minutes with compatible DC public fast charging
  • Charge port: Standard NACS port for expanded charging compatibility
  • Charging access: More than 250,000 available public chargers across the U.S. and Canada through Chevrolet-supported charging access
  • Battery confidence: Backed by an 8-year or 100,000-mile battery limited warranty

A Redesigned Interior With Practical Comfort

Inside, the 2027 Chevrolet Bolt takes a noticeable step forward. The redesigned cabin focuses on useful space, better materials, and technology that is easy to see and reach. A large 11.3-inch diagonal touchscreen places infotainment functions front and center, while the 11-inch diagonal Driver Information Center keeps important vehicle details clearly visible behind the steering wheel. This dual-screen setup helps the cabin feel modern without making the driving experience overly complicated.

Chevrolet also paid attention to small everyday details that matter. The newly designed center console offers more room to maneuver, and the cup holders are designed to accommodate larger insulated tumblers. Available underfloor storage adds up to 4 cubic feet of space for items you may want to keep out of sight. The compact footprint makes Bolt easy to maneuver, while the flexible interior helps the vehicle feel ready for real errands, gear, bags, and cargo.

LT and RS: Two Ways to Drive Electric

The 2027 Bolt lineup includes the LT and the first-ever Bolt RS. The LT is designed as a versatile, value-focused model with essential technology, strong EV capability, and a practical feature set. It includes the NACS charge port, 210 horsepower, the large touchscreen display, the digital Driver Information Center, and more than 20 standard safety and driver assistance features.

The RS adds a sportier look and a more expressive personality. It includes unique front-end styling, RS badging, Gloss Black roof rails, 17-inch Black wheels, Black Evotex seating with Red stitching, and multi-color ambient lighting. For drivers who want an EV that looks a little more energetic while keeping the Bolt’s practical foundation, the RS is a welcome addition to the lineup.

  • 2027 Bolt LT: A smart choice for shoppers who want strong EV value, key technology, compact maneuverability, and everyday comfort
  • 2027 Bolt RS: A sport-inspired option with bolder design details, upgraded interior accents, and a more athletic visual presence

Exterior Design That Feels More Confident

The new Bolt has a more expressive shape, with updated front and rear fascia, new lighting elements, and details that help it stand apart from previous versions. The overall look is sleek and compact, making it suitable for tight parking, urban streets, and busy shopping centers, while still giving the vehicle a more premium and contemporary presence.

Chevrolet is also offering fresh exterior colors that help Bolt feel more personal. Options include bold choices such as Habanero Orange, Marina Blue Metallic, Relic Green Metallic on LT, and Atomic Yellow on RS. Combined with available 17-inch wheels, Gloss Black mirrors, and RS-specific touches, the 2027 Bolt proves that an affordable EV can still have plenty of style.

Technology Designed to Make Driving Easier

The 2027 Chevrolet Bolt includes intuitive technology aimed at making every drive more connected. Google built-in compatibility brings familiar voice assistance, navigation support, and entertainment access into the vehicle. Available wireless phone charging helps reduce cabin clutter, while the large center touchscreen keeps key controls within easy reach.

One of the most notable available features is Super Cruise driver assistance technology. Chevrolet describes Bolt as the most affordable vehicle to offer hands-free driving capability when properly equipped. Super Cruise is designed for compatible roads and can help make longer drives feel more relaxed, while still requiring driver attention. For EV shoppers who want advanced technology in a more attainable package, this is a major point of interest.

Safety Comes Standard in a Big Way

Chevrolet emphasizes safety throughout the 2027 Bolt lineup, with more than 20 standard safety and driver assistance features. This is especially valuable in a compact EV because shoppers do not have to move far up the lineup to get a strong foundation of confidence-enhancing features. Safety and driver assistance technologies are not substitutes for attentive driving, but helpful alerts and support systems can make a meaningful difference during daily travel.

  • Adaptive Cruise Control: Helps maintain a selected following gap behind a detected vehicle ahead
  • Front and Rear Park Assist: Provides alerts for nearby detected objects or vehicles when parking
  • IntelliBeam: Automatically turns high beams on or off in certain conditions at speeds above 25 mph
  • Available HD Surround Vision: Helps provide a more complete view around the vehicle when maneuvering
  • Driver awareness: Feature performance can be affected by visibility, surroundings, road conditions, and system limitations

Frequently Asked Questions:

How far can the 2027 Chevrolet Bolt drive on a full charge?

Chevrolet estimates the 2027 Bolt will offer up to 262 EPA-estimated miles of electric range. Actual range can vary based on driving habits, speed, climate control use, terrain, vehicle condition, and other factors.

Does the 2027 Chevrolet Bolt use the NACS charge port?

Yes. The 2027 Bolt comes with a standard NACS charge port, which helps improve access to compatible public charging stations, including many Tesla Superchargers.

How fast can the 2027 Bolt charge?

With compatible public DC fast charging, Chevrolet estimates the 2027 Bolt can charge from 10% to 80% in about 25 minutes. Charging times can vary depending on charger capability, battery condition, temperature, and other factors.

What is different about the 2027 Bolt RS?

The RS is the first-ever sporty Bolt trim. It adds details such as a unique front grille, RS badging, Gloss Black roof rails, 17-inch Black wheels, Black Evotex seating with Red stitching, and multi-color ambient lighting.
